Wells is the smallest city in England lying in beautiful countryside between the Somerset Levels and the Mendip Hills. The City has local markets twice a week in the Market Square close the Cathedral and moated Bishops Palace. There is also a broad range of societies and activities and excellent State & private schools in the area including Wells Blue School, Wells Cathedral School and Millfield School. The major towns of the area, Bristol, Bath, Taunton and Yeovil are all within commuting distance. Castle Cary is the nearest train station with fast links to London.
